## 3.1.0 — Changed defaults

Brineworks transcode farm now defaults to two-pass encoding off, priority lanes on, and a 4-hour job timeout (down from 12). Existing presets unaffected; only newly created pools pick these up. Reviewers: diff against your pool manifests before merging. New pools initialize with the following values.

deployment values, yafop-tahof:
HOLIX_HOST=holix.zemvarsys.internal
HOLIX_PORT=3306

Runbook: Rate-parity checker deploy (Tidewatch).

Welcome aboard! Tidewatch scrapes partner hotel rates nightly and flags parity breaks for the Somerhale account team. Deploys are low-drama: run the build script, check the diff report, and push to the crawler fleet before 18:00 so the nightly run isn't interrupted. The push step asks for the deploy key — use the one below:

release key, fajef-kajeg: bky19_LdLu6Ne6FLi8he2c24d

# Break-Glass: Catalog Cache Invalidation

Scope: the Pinrow product catalog at Veldstone Retail. If stale prices persist after a purge and the Hollowmere invalidation queue is wedged, use break-glass to flush the edge tier directly. Contractors: get verbal sign-off from the catalog lead first. Steps: open the Hollowmere admin shell, select emergency-flush, confirm the tenant, and run it once — repeated flushes thrash the origin. Access is logged and expires after 20 minutes. Unseal the admin shell with the passphrase below.

recovery phrase for kahop-tajog: istix-casvan

## Authentication

All calls to the Driftpost parcel-tracking webhook admin API require a service key. No OAuth, no session tokens — key only, sent in the request header. Keys are scoped per environment; staging and prod are never interchangeable. Don't commit keys to the repo; they live in the Lockbin vault and in CI secrets. Rotation happens quarterly, announced in the team channel. For local development against the sandbox, use the following key:

API key for hafop-bajog: qvz15-rtly2XOSD9Zm19U